ABINGTON, PA- The Penn State Abington women's tennis team hosted the College of Saint Elizabeth for their first NEAC competition of the season. The Nittany Lions defeated the eagles 9-0 and improve to 2-4 on the season.
The Nittany Lions posted three straight in doubles action with 8-3, 8-0, and 8-0 wins in each match.
In singles action the Nittany Lions swept all six of their matches with wins from
Stephanie Jin,
Michelle Mirjani,
Marta Tymchenko,
Isabella Blackwell,
Michelle Ly, and
Jenny Vuong
Tomorrow Abington will travel to Madison, New Jersey where they will face Fairleigh Dickinson University- Florham at 4:00pm.
